  • Struggling Kraft Heinz sells dairy brands to Lactalis
    15 Sep 2020—wpxi.com
    Kraft Heinz said Tuesday that it is selling its natural cheese business — including its Cracker Barrel and Breakstone’s brands — to French dairy company Lactalis Group as part of a larger restructuring. The $3.2 billion sale includes Kraft Heinz production facilities in Tulare, California; Walton, New York; and Wausau, Wisconsin. About 750 employees at those plants will transfer to Lactalis Group. Included in the sale are Kraft Heinz’s natural, grated, cultured and specialty cheese businesses...
